Inflation has been on the rise for 10 straight months in the world&#8217;s fastest-growing economy, according to data from LSEG.<\/p>\n<p>India&#8217;s food inflation climbed to 5.95% in August from 5.52% a month ago, India&#8217;s Ministry of Statistics and Program Implementation\u00a0said in a Monday release. Goods transport service inflation rose the sharpest to over 14% in August, while personal transport inflation rose over 7%, the release said. <\/p>\n<p>India is among the countries most\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.cnbc.com\/2026\/03\/02\/india-impact-iran-middle-east-conflict-oil-prices-airlines.html\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">vulnerable to the supply disruptions<\/a>\u00a0caused by the Iran war. It imports\u00a0nearly 85% of its fuel needs\u00a0and relies on the\u00a0energy supply chain through the\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.cnbc.com\/2026\/06\/11\/us-india-lng-lpg-supply.html\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Strait of Hormuz<\/a>. Global oil prices\u00a0have <a href=\"https:\/\/www.cnbc.com\/2026\/09\/13\/oil-price-iran-war-strait-hormuz-saudi-pipeline.html\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">soared past $100 a barrel<\/a> and rose further on Monday after Saudi Arabia\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.cnbc.com\/2026\/09\/13\/oil-price-iran-war-strait-hormuz-saudi-pipeline.html\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">closed a key East-West energy pipeline<\/a>\u00a0following damage from a drone attack.<\/p>\n<p>Despite rising food and fuel prices over the last several months, India&#8217;s economic growth for the June quarter was <a href=\"https:\/\/www.cnbc.com\/2026\/08\/31\/india-economy-gdp-energy-el-nino.html\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">stronger than expected at 7.8%<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>Global brokerages Morgan Stanley and Citi have raised their economic growth forecast for the 12 months ending in March 2027 to 7.3% from less than 7% earlier. \u00a0However, economists do see the pace of growth slowing down in the second half of the year.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;Even as GDP growth has held up well thus far, some softening could be in order,&#8221; HSBC said in its report at the beginning of September. High base, cuts to public capex for meeting fiscal deficit targets and the impact of deficient rains on sowing patterns are some of the key reasons the brokerage expects India&#8217;s growth to slow over the next few quarters.<\/p>\n<p>The Indian central bank has repeatedly emphasized its focus on core inflation, which is yet to become a major concern.
